Consett 2 Silsden 1

SILSDEN’S interest in this season’s FA Vase was ended by a clinical Consett side at Belle View.

The home side took the lead after just 15 seconds when Michael Mackay finished clinically after collecting Chris Moore’s lay-off.

It was the only goal of the first half but most of the credit for that went to Cobbydalers’ keeper Dannny Thorpe.

Consett doubled their advantage through an early second-half penalty. A penetrating run by Matty Slocombe was ended by a foul and Mackay stepped forward to slot home from the spot.

Ben Crabtree netted a superb free-kick for Silsden eight minutes from time but Consett hung on.

Silsden spokesman Kevin Knappy said: “It is a 4G surface up there but it played well and they are a very good side.

"We didn’t play well in the first half and Danny kept us in it but once Ben hit that late free-kick it was game on. They probably deserved to go through though.”
